University of Illinois Springfield
Springfield, IL · Public · Midsize city · UIS
Public institution in Springfield, IL · 2,292 undergraduates · 84% acceptance rate · $57,103 median earnings 10 years after entry.

Campus facts
- Founded in 1969source
- Athletic nickname: "Prairie Stars"source
- Competes in NCAA Division IIsource
- School colors: Whitesource
- Mascot: Orionsource
- Formerly known as "Sangamon State University" (1969–1995)source
- Formerly known as "University of Illinois at Springfield" (1995–2021)source
- Athletic conference: GLVCsource
- Notable alum: Bobby McFerrinsource
